Commit 900e5d3b6c825db9c397830e7e3d5fa91c74d28b

Carlos Martín Nieto 2015-06-15T08:26:06

Merge pull request #3154 from tkelman/win-openssl-v0.22 Fix MinGW build against openssl on maint/v0.22

diff --git a/src/openssl_stream.c b/src/openssl_stream.c
index c02df0b..9ddf6e4 100644
--- a/src/openssl_stream.c
+++ b/src/openssl_stream.c
@@ -8,9 +8,6 @@
 #ifdef GIT_SSL
 
 #include <ctype.h>
-#include <sys/types.h>
-#include <sys/socket.h>
-#include <netinet/in.h>
 
 #include "global.h"
 #include "posix.h"
@@ -19,6 +16,12 @@
 #include "netops.h"
 #include "git2/transport.h"
 
+#ifndef GIT_WIN32
+# include <sys/types.h>
+# include <sys/socket.h>
+# include <netinet/in.h>
+#endif
+
 #include <openssl/ssl.h>
 #include <openssl/err.h>
 #include <openssl/x509v3.h>